Mushrooms on toast

Very ordinary but very delicious. I had three mushrooms to use up, so I sliced them roughly into chunky pieces, and pan-fried them in olive oil and butter. I toasted a wholemeal slice, and spread pesto on it. I added powdered garlic (no time for the real thing). Then I tossed the mushrooms, by now nice and juicy, onto the toast and added black pepper. I finally sprinkled chopped mint on top. Yes, it’s the wrong herb for it, but I had some around and it actually tasted very good. This is a first class snack, or even part of a light lunch. Many a student whose culinary skills currently stop at beans on toast could manage this vastly more appetizing dish.
